Tips For Choosing Hotels When Traveling

Traveling can be a great way to explore new places and discover the world. But it’s also important to find the right accommodation for your trip. This is especially true if you’re going to be traveling with friends or family.

There are many factors to consider when choosing a hotel, including price, location, amenities, and reviews. It can be difficult to narrow down your options, so it’s important to know what your priorities are before you start booking.

The first thing to think about is where you want to be in the city. If you’re planning on spending most of your time sightseeing, it might be best to choose a hotel near a major tourist attraction. This will make it easier for you to get around the city without worrying about public transport or finding your way to attractions by foot.

Alternatively, if you’re staying in a city and don’t plan on touring much, it might be better to choose a hotel that is located a little bit farther from the main attractions. This will give you more flexibility when it comes to getting around the city, and will help you save money on transportation costs.

Another factor to consider is how close the hotel is to public transportation. If you’re traveling in a city that has plenty of trains and buses, it might be best to stay at a hotel near one of these so that you can easily get to the main sights.

Some hotels also offer shuttle services to and from the airport. If this is something you’re looking for, it’s a good idea to ask the hotel about their shuttle service before booking your room.

It’s always a good idea to check the reviews for a hotel before making your reservation. This will allow you to find out what other travelers have thought about the hotel and whether it’s a good fit for your needs.

Sometimes, a hotel might address issues that are pointed out in the reviews. This information should be listed on the hotel’s website.
